IN RE CLAYTON

No. 49S00-0008-DI-493.

778 N.E.2d 404 (2002)

In the Matter of Dan L. CLAYTON.

Supreme Court of Indiana.

November 15, 2002.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Bruce A. Kotzan, Indianapolis, IN, for the Respondent.

Donald R. Lundberg, Executive Secretary, Fredrick L. Rice, Staff Attorney, Indianapolis, IN, for the Indiana Supreme Court Disciplinary Commission.


DISCIPLINARY ACTION

PER CURIAM.

Dan L. Clayton, an attorney admitted to practice law in this state in 1971, committed several acts of misconduct, which he attributes to addiction to alcohol and certain prescription drugs. Today, we suspend him from the practice of law.
